2012-04-14 03:09:57 +0000 2012-04-14 03:09:57 +0000
12
12
Advertisement

如何在Windows 7上截图,并像Mac一样在桌面上自动创建截图文件?

Advertisement

我试图找到信息,我们如何在Windows 7上截图,实际上会创建一个屏幕截图文件,如.png在你的桌面上,像在Mac上,你可以做到这一点,按commashift+4。

在Windows中,我所知道的是,我可以通过按PrtScn = Windows捕获整个屏幕,并将其复制到剪贴板。

或者对于活动窗口,我可以按住Alt键,然后按PrtScn = Windows只捕获当前活动窗口并将其复制到剪贴板。

现在我使用maComFort,它给了我类似Mac键盘的功能,我可以用Mac OS X同样的方式进行截图,但实际上它改变了我键盘上的许多键,我不喜欢这样。

所以我想知道是否有更好的方法?

Advertisement
Advertisement

答案 (6)

13
13
13
2012-04-14 05:06:41 +0000

只需使用内置的Snipping工具,它就会捕捉到屏幕并提示你将其保存为.png文件。它将捕获屏幕并提示您将其保存为.png文件。如果您想让它在您点击PrintScrn时运行,那么就使用AutoHotKey将其绑定到该键上。

11
11
11
2012-04-14 04:35:41 +0000

我使用 Screenpresso 。它是免费的,可移植的,并且只使用打印键(带修饰符)。

11
Advertisement
11
11
2012-04-14 04:54:47 +0000
Advertisement

下载 NirCmd , AutoHotKey 并安装它们。(将nircmd文件复制到Windows目录或解压到新的文件夹)。

将其改为存放nircmd可执行文件的相关目录和桌面路径。

c:\path\to\nircmd.exe savescreenshot c:\path\to\desktop\Screenshot.png

如果一切正常,你应该会在桌面上看到一个截图。现在让PrintScreen来执行该命令。这就是AutoHotKey的作用。

我刚刚修改了脚本在这里找到。用记事本创建一个新的".ahk “文件,粘贴这个文件并根据需要进行修改。

#NoEnv
SendMode Input
SetWorkingDir, path:\to\desktop

PRINTSCREEN::Run, c:\path\to\nircmd.exe savescreenshot c:\path\to\desktop\Screenshot_%A_Now%.png
!PRINTSCREEN::Run, c:\path\to\nircmd.exe savescreenshotwin c:\path\to\desktop\Screenshot_%A_Now%.png
return

现在使用 "Convert .ahk to .exe "工具,该工具与AutoHotKey一起安装,并创建一个可执行文件。

运行该可执行文件,然后按PrintScreen (和Alt+PrintScreen);看看是否成功。

现在只需将该可执行文件的快捷方式添加到你的启动文件夹中(每当你启动时,它就会自动加载)。

编辑:修改为文件添加Alt+PrintScreen和时间戳。

4
4
4
2012-04-17 06:44:02 +0000

你可以试试Purrint。 http://www.bcheck.net/apps/

它给你提供了使用格式的选择,基于你第一次配置程序时给屏幕截图的扩展。当然,你也可以选择你想让屏幕截图去哪里。

0
Advertisement
0
0
2019-01-13 12:23:10 +0000
Advertisement

顺便说一下,如果你已经碰巧使用了IrfanView(我碰巧使用了,因为它是一个不可思议的超级方便的工具,用于快速编辑图像和打开/转换各种图像格式),有一个启动屏幕捕捉会话的选项(选项->/捕捉/屏幕截图…)(我附上了显示的对话框,包含所有可能的选项,如目标目录和快捷按钮,以及目标图像文件的命名和格式。 (我附上了显示的对话框,包含了所有可能的选项,比如目标目录和快捷按钮,以及目标图像文件的命名和格式)

[编辑]在写这篇文章的时候IrfanView是 “FREEWARE (用于非商业用途)”

-1
-1
-1
2014-06-02 13:05:59 +0000

我写了一个简单的python脚本来捕捉屏幕上的热键到文件。

脚本和它的快捷方式是 这里

有两个文件 printscreen-win.lnk 和 printscreen-win.py

把它们都复制到 c:\utils,这个路径可以改变,但你需要编辑快捷方式文件。

快捷方式文件期望你的Python是:

c:\Python27\pythonw.exe

将快捷方式复制到你的桌面,并从其属性中制作一个 “快捷键"。我默认使用的是Ctrl + Alt + S

一旦你执行脚本,它将在`…\Desktop\screen我写了一个简单的python脚本来捕捉屏幕上的热键到文件。

脚本和它的快捷方式是 这里

有两个文件 printscreen-win.lnk 和 printscreen-win.py

把它们都复制到 c:\utils,这个路径可以改变,但你需要编辑快捷方式文件。

快捷方式文件期望你的Python是:

c:\Python27\pythonw.exe

将快捷方式复制到你的桌面,并从其属性中制作一个 "快捷键"。我默认使用的是Ctrl + Alt + S

一旦你执行脚本,它将在

下保存一个新的屏幕截图,你需要Python 2.x和[ PIL ]0x3&。

享受吧

Advertisement

相关问题

3
28
13
7
4
Advertisement